[QUOTE="kiwikid, post: 1656623, member: 56094"] At this stage I own two Meopta scopes, one is the Meopro 4.5-14x44mm HTR which is mounted on a Weihrauch 22 Hornet. The other is a Meopro 3-9x42mm on my wife's CZ 512 semi auto 22. The optics in both these scopes is incredibly good considering the price is about half that of top tier scopes. The HTR model tracks very well. All in all I am very impressed with Meopta products. [/QUOTE]
